KPF_* may be larger than 32, which will trigger -Wshift-count-overflow warning. All KPF_* values currently used in "1 << KPF_xxx" are smaller than 33, so no warning is triggered with current code. Replace all occurrences of "1 << KPF_*" with the BIT_ULL() macro to ensure all shifts are performed on a 64-bit unsigned type. This makes the code robust, and safe for future extension. No functional change is intended.
